site stats

React setstate async

WebApr 17, 2024 · I know the setState calls don’t look asynchronous, and inadvertent calls can introduce some bugs. It’s a good practice (it’s by design in React) delaying reconciliation … WebNov 20, 2024 · In React, we use setState() to update the state of any component. Now setState() does not immediately mutate this state, rather it creates a pending state …

React.js Image Upload with Preview Display example - BezKoder

WebOct 30, 2024 · An async effect is an effect calling a promise and setting some state based on that promise. With an example − Fetching a user First approach The problem Problem, … WebMar 29, 2024 · setState is asynchronous A gentle introduction to setState, for React developers, pt 1. setState is asynchronous. “Asynchronous” is a big word. So what does it mean in practice? It means you can’t call … lithuania football badge https://lifesportculture.com

如何在react中处理报错 - 知乎 - 知乎专栏

WebAug 20, 2024 · To use it, proceed with the installation of the module in your project using the following command using NPM in your terminal: npm install --save react-autocomplete. After the installation you will be able to import the components as Autocomplete from 'react-autocomplete'. For more information about this library, please visit the official ... WebTo help you get started, we’ve selected a few react-async-hook exam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an … WebOct 6, 2024 · Don’t forget to avoid the max using state and respect React rendering props cascade. Don’t forget setState is async. Don’t forget setState can take an object or a … lithuania food prices

Why is setState in reactjs Async instead of Sync?

Category:React setState & its Async Nature by Jeanette Abell

Tags:React setstate async

React setstate async

Understanding React setState() (Callback, Async-Await …

WebFeb 7, 2016 · Because setState is asynchronous, subsequent calls in the same update cycle will overwrite previous updates, and the previous changes will be lost. Consider the … WebNov 30, 2024 · The reason React threw that warning was because I used a setState inside the async function. That's not a crime. But React will try to update that state even when the component is unmounted, and that's kind of a crime (a leakage crime). This is the code that led to the warning above

React setstate async

Did you know?

WebTo perform an action in a React component after calling setState, such as making an AJAX request or throwing an error, we use the setState callback. Here’s something extremely important to know about state in React: updating a React component’s state is asynchronous. It does not happen immediately. WebFeb 24, 2024 · Setup React Image Upload with Preview Project. Open cmd at the folder you want to save Project folder, run command: npx create-react-app react-image-upload …

React SetState within a async function. I'm trying to learn React making a weather application and I have got stacked using the async/await function. Here is the trouble I'm facing.. I have a function which does a axios call to an api and then I'm trying to set some state variables. WebUnderstanding React setState () (Callback, Async-Await and Promises) React is a component-based user interface library. This means, your application is a set of …

WebOn the Async nature of setState() Gist: React batches updates and flushes it out once per frame (perf optimization) However, in some cases React has no control over batching, … WebApr 11, 2024 · React competing async data loads. In my React app (built using React-Bootstrap and functional components) I have a couple of places where data is loaded asynchronously. One example is the first page after login, where options are added to the sidebar component and notifications are added to the main panel. I'll include some …

Web1) setState actions are asynchronous and are batched for performance gains. This is explained in the documentation of setState. setState() does not immediately mutate …

WebAug 2, 2024 · The setState creates an update object to hook onto the fiber object and then schedules performSyncWorkOnRoot to re-render it. In React 17, setState is executed in batch because executionContext is set before execution, but in functions like setTimeout and event listener, executionContext is not set and setState is executed synchronously. lithuania football kitWebJul 11, 2024 · The pitfalls of async operations via React Context API React provides a nice API to share state globally and across components, the Context API, but while working at scale in Jira, we... lithuania foodsWebJun 30, 2024 · const [state, setState] = useState (initialValue) Not sure if you get the destructuring, so for those who didn't catch it at first glance: I could do something like this: const array = useState (initialValue) And then I could use the state, inside position 0, as array [0], and the handler to setState, inside position 1, as array [1]. lithuania footballersWebFeb 24, 2024 · Initialize Axios for React HTTP Client Let’s install axios with command: npm install [email protected]. Or: yarn add [email protected] Under src folder, we create http-common.js file with following code: import axios from "axios"; export default axios.create ( { baseURL: "http://localhost:8080", headers: { "Content-type": "application/json" } }); lithuania football leagueWebApr 12, 2024 · const [state, setState, getState] = useRefState(); This hook can be used to interact with the current state of the component from a process spawned from an old render cycle. async () => { //... const fresh = getState(); setState(fresh.process()); //... } useFuture lithuania foreign affairs ministryWebJul 28, 2024 · The setState method is the method to update the component’s internal state. It’s an asynchronous method that’s batched. This means that multiple setState calls are … lithuania football resultshttp://reactjs.org/docs/state-and-lifecycle.html lithuania football ranking